Cultural Traditions Of Nature Imagery In Art
Nature inspired wall art ideas for organic interior design are deeply connected to long artistic traditions where natural imagery served both aesthetic and symbolic purposes. In many historical cultures, plants and animals were not depicted merely as decorative subjects but as representations of cosmic balance and life cycles. Medieval manuscripts, folk textiles, and early decorative painting frequently included botanical motifs arranged in rhythmic patterns. These images expressed ideas about growth, continuity, and the relationship between humans and the natural world.
